Corona del Mar Takes Down Rancho Cucamonga in CIF-SS Playoff Opener (2025)

Rancho Cucamonga – Cougars Gym

The Corona del Mar High School boys’ basketball team delivered an electric fourth-quarter performance to secure a 73-62 victory over Rancho Cucamonga in the first round of the CIF-SS playoffs on Wednesday night.

From the outset, the game was close, with CdM holding a narrow 15-13 lead at the end of the first quarter. Both teams exchanged baskets in the second period, but the Sea Kings managed to maintain their lead heading into halftime with a 29-25 advantage.

As the third quarter unfolded, CdM’s offense momentarily stalled, allowing Rancho Cucamonga to cut into the deficit. However, a fourth-quarter explosion sealed the win for the visiting Sea Kings. CdM stacked up 31 points in the final quarter, outscoring Rancho Cucamonga by a decisive margin.

Maxwell Scott led the way for Corona del Mar with an impressive 22 points, shooting 9-for-18 from the field while knocking down four three-pointers. His ability to space the floor and convert from beyond the arc was a key factor in keeping Rancho Cucamonga’s defense on its heels. Luke Mirhashemi added 15 points on efficient shooting (5-for-7) and was perfect from the free-throw line, while Oliver Nakra contributed 13 points and seven made free throws, helping CdM ice the game in the closing moments.

Rancho Cucamonga’s offense was led by Aaron Glass, who tallied a game-high 23 points while draining three three-pointers. Mckel Shedrick provided a strong inside presence, scoring 18 points and pulling down nine rebounds. Despite their efforts, Rancho Cucamonga was unable to overcome CdM’s late-game success.

Defensively, CdM showed discipline and hustle, forcing turnovers and limiting Rancho Cucamonga’s scoring opportunities in key moments. Ganon Overfelt played a key role on both ends of the floor, tallying nine points, five assists, and two steals. Jackson Harlan also made an impact, scoring 12 points while grabbing 10 rebounds, finishing with a double-double.

With this victory, Corona del Mar advances to the next round of the CIF-SS playoffs, carrying momentum from a well-executed road win. Rancho Cucamonga, despite the loss, showcased strong individual performances but struggled to match CdM’s fourth-quarter firepower.

The Sea Kings will now prepare for their upcoming matchup as they continue their playoff journey, hoping to build on their strong finish against Rancho Cucamonga.
